Modular Design and Rapid Deployment Innovation
Modern asphalt mixing plant mobile manufacturers optimize equipment through modular architecture enabling rapid assembly and simplified site preparation, directly addressing contractor demands for faster project mobilization. Advanced designs feature pre-assembled component clusters—drum/burner units, aggregate handling systems, control cabins—mounted on integrated trailers requiring minimal on-site connection work. This approach reduces deployment time from 10-14 days to 3-5 days while maintaining production consistency, fundamentally changing how contractors evaluate how much does an asphalt mixing plant cost when considering schedule compression benefits.
Modular structures enable contractors to reduce site preparation expenses by 40-50% compared to traditional stationary equipment, as mobile asphalt mixing plant designs eliminate extensive concrete foundation requirements and complex utility infrastructure. Contractors preparing projects in remote locations or temporary sites benefit significantly from this deployment advantage, as modular equipment operates on compacted gravel surfaces with simplified electrical and fuel connections. Transport Systems and Logistics Optimization
Advanced transport system design distinguishes premium asphalt mixing plant mobile equipment from conventional portable designs, enabling efficient relocation between project sites without excessive handling complexity. Manufacturers integrating self-contained utility systems—onboard power generation, fuel storage, water supply—eliminate dependency on site infrastructure, reducing deployment time and enabling operation in logistics-constrained environments. Contractors evaluating how much does an asphalt mixing plant cost should assess total relocation expense including transport loads, site preparation, and commissioning time, recognizing that efficient transport design reduces per-move costs by $8,000-$15,000 compared to equipment requiring specialized heavy-haul transport.
Transport optimization directly influences purchasing decisions for contractors managing multi-site projects requiring 3-4 seasonal relocations. Mobile asphalt mixing plant equipment fitting standard flatbed trailers ($3,500-$5,500 per move) accumulates significantly lower relocation costs than oversized equipment requiring specialized heavy-haul transport ($8,000-$12,000 per move). Over five-year equipment life involving multiple relocations, transport efficiency differences accumulate to $20,000-$40,000, often exceeding equipment cost premiums for compact mobile designs. Automated Operation and Production Consistency
Automated operation systems represent emerging design improvements reshaping how much does an asphalt mixing plant cost evaluation, as contractors increasingly recognize consistency benefits justifying equipment premiums. Advanced asphalt mixing plant mobile equipment integrates proportional burner control, multi-point thermal sensing, and responsive aggregate feed systems that maintain production consistency (±2% gradation, ±8 degrees temperature) across varying site conditions and operator experience levels. This automation capability enables less-experienced operators to maintain highway-quality production consistency, reducing training requirements and operational errors that accumulate material waste.
